π― Which Scenario Are You?
Choosing an electric pressure cooker usually comes down to one question: Are you preserving food, or are you just trying to get dinner on the table? Here is how to filter your search.
β What is your primary concern?
If you plan to can, look for USDA-certified safety controls first. If you are just cooking, prioritize the number of presets and how much space you have.
β What is your budget level?
Commercial-grade models are built for longevity and extreme volume, but they are often overkill for a standard home kitchen.
β How often will you use it?
If you are cooking daily, look for models with quick-clean surfaces and easy-to-read displays. Occasional users can get away with simpler, more manual interfaces.
Frequently Asked Questions
What size 10 quart electric pressure cooker is best for large families?
A 12.8-quart model is perfect for parties or bulk prepping for 18-28 people. For a standard family of four to six, an 8-quart unit is generally the sweet spot.
Can a 10 quart electric pressure cooker be used for canning?
Yes, but stick to models explicitly marketed as ‘canners’ with USDA-approved safety features. Standard pressure cookers don’t always maintain the consistent temperature needed for safe preservation.
How do I choose between a pressure cooker and a canner?
Pressure cookers are designed for speed and versatility in daily meals. Electric canners are specialized tools built to maintain stable, specific temperatures over long periods for food safety.
Are commercial 10 quart electric pressure cookers worth the cost?
Commercial models prioritize ruggedness and high-capacity output. Home versions are generally more focused on smart features, compact design, and ease of use.
What features should I look for in a 10 quart electric pressure cooker?
Check the capacity, safety certifications, and the range of presets. If you are a beginner, look for models with clear digital progress bars that explain what the machine is currently doing.
